The Partner Operations Lead, Events brings strategic and operational rigor, a deep understanding of events, a natural passion for on the ground experiences and operations and incredible stakeholder management skills to deliver best-in-class activations that make Airbnb shine across its Events portfolio. They will be responsible for supporting and implementing event operations to establish Airbnb’s activations across a variety of event partnerships, from sports to art, music and culture.
Responsibilities:
- Develop experiential plans and support experiences across a variety of event partnerships worldwide
- Collaborate across functions, markets and regions, to develop highly effective, design-forward, localized ideas for implementation.
- Gain cross-functional, event partner and leadership buy-in to deliver a creative, high-quality, impactful guest experience.
- Partner closely with internal cross-functional teams, event partners, and agencies to ensure operational excellence bringing our plans to life for our guests and event attendees.
- Deliver creatively excellent on site activations, including but not limited to: experiences and services on site, experiential venues, venue hospitality, support of on site media, social media, UGC and other various onsite amplifications, ensuring all activities feel local and personal.
- Conduct RFPs, build contracts and SOWs, support POs and ensure timely payments for execution across all assets involved, working closely with procurement, legal, and finance.
- Oversee internal teams and agencies, manage and track budgets, delivering on time and on budget.
- Work with finance and operations on budget forecasting and actualizing; ensuring timely SOWs and contracts with partners at all times; provide regular activity updates and reconciliations.
- Manage analytics and reporting for success of these activations working closely with event partners, data science and FP&A
- Conduct after action reviews on projects including results, lessons learned and best practices to global, regional and local internal and external partners, building learnings into improvements for future projects.
- Deep subject matter expertise at event operations - management, client or agency side, with preference in the sports, music or arts/culture.
- Significant experience working closely with agencies, event partners and internal teams, including marketing, communications, FP&A and data analytics functions.
- Deep experience delivering globally integrated creative activations supported by brand, comms, media, and data strategy.
